Karachi: The Gold price in Pakistan increased by Rs4,000 per tola on Wednesday.
As per the information provided by the All-Pakistan Sarafa Gems and Jewellers Association (APSGJA), the cost of 24-carat gold experienced an increase by Rs4,000 per tola, reaching a value of Rs2,19,000.
Similarly, the price of 10 grams of 24-karat pure gold increased by Rs4,030 and traded at Rs1,88,615 per 10 grams.
In the International market, the price of pure gold of 24 karats decreased by $15 per ounce to $1911 per ounce, as reported by the association.
On the other hand, the price of 24 karat silver per tola and 10 grams also remained the same at Rs2,750 and Rs2,357.68 respectively.
